When can lymphatic drainage help medically?

Instrumental lymphatic drainage is not only used in cosmetics, but also has its medical applications.

Lymphatic drainage is used not only for detoxification and body shaping, but also as an effective support for a wide range of health problems. For example, it helps with venous insufficiency, chronic swelling, arthritis, gout or neuropathy. It relieves carpal tunnel syndrome, lower limb ischemia, Reynaud's syndrome, diabetic angiopathy or acrocyanosis.

It is also recommended as part of care after trauma, surgery, burns or cancer treatment (e.g. after breast ablation, removal of nodules or radiotherapy). It is also used for trophic skin disorders, obesity and algodystrophic syndrome.

Lymphatic drainage as a treatment and prevention of cellulite

In addition to the above, lymphatic drainage is also recommended as a prevention and treatment for cellulite due to its ability to flush toxins from the body. In the fight against cellulite, lymphatic drainage helps significantly. Unpopular orange skin is caused by the deposition of waste, fat and water in the subcutaneous tissue. With the help of special lymphatic massage, it is possible to activate the lymph, achieve the flushing of harmful substances from the body, and thus improve the quality and condition of the skin.

Lymphatic drainage of the lower limbs

This is a lymphatic massage that is recommended for people with regular excessive strain on the lower limbs, such as standing or, on the contrary, during sedentary work. In these cases, there is an excessive load on the lymphatic system. Lymphatic massage can help anyone with tired and swollen legs. It is also a very useful complement before and after plastic surgery, and also after liposuction.
